The one treatment that could be seen as the one most responsible for bringing cosmetic dentistry to the main stream is teeth whitening. It’s hard to find one person who is happy with how white their teeth are, so the chance to lighten your teeth in a quick and pain-free manner does have mass appeal. Professional whitening does tend to yield the best results and as it is usually only takes around ninety minutes is perfect for having the day before your big night out.

Dental implants are a dental treatment for those who have missing teeth or have lost teeth due to decay or an accident. Fixed to the jaw bone, the implant holds a crown or bridge in place that will then function and look just like a natural tooth. The cosmetic side of this treatment involves matching the colour of the implant and crown to the remaining teeth so that it doesn’t stand out – leaving you with a full, gleaming smile.
